Description
1 postcard from Tetsuzo (Ted) Hirasaki to Clara Breed.
Transcription:
Sept. 16, 1942/Dear Miss Breed,/Received the surprise pkg yesterday late in the afternoon. The chocolates just wilted when the box was opened 'cuz it was 110 inside the barracks. Wilted or not they were really welcome. I passed it out among our neighbors as they (the chocolate) wouldn't keep as the afternoons are getting hotter. However to compensate the morns are colder. brrrrr Had a wonderful sunrise this morning 'cuz there were clouds low on the horizon that turned golden from the rays of the sun. Otherwise the Dust Heat etc. are the same. /Sincerely/Ted./My regards to your mother and Miss McNarry./P.S. Your card came just as I was about to mail this card TH
